Most ducted pellet stoves have automatic ignition systems that light the pellets instantly upon entering the combustion chamber. They also come with fans that draw warm air or push it into various rooms of the house via a series of diffusers or vents. This forced ventilation system is able to deliver warmth to rooms as far as 16 meters away from the stove.

In addition to heating multiple rooms the ducted pellet stove can be employed to heat domestic water. A water jacket is connected to the hot water storage and the thermal energy generated by the stove is transferred to the water heater. This method is an environmentally friendly way to reduce the use of electricity by 30%.
